Once a year, we get a glimpse into the future when Pinterest unveils its Pinterest Predicts trend report, revealing the home decor trends we will be coveting in the upcoming year. According to their experts, 2025 is set to be a bold year in interior design. Here are the five standout trends you should keep an eye on:

The Trends Pinterest Predicts Will Be Big News in 2025

1. Cherry Coded

Cherry Coded Cherry red is predicted to dominate the color palette of 2025. Moving on from previous trends, Pinterest forecasts a rise in this vibrant shade across various elements, including make-up and home decor. Searches for 'cherry bedroom' are already up 100%, with 'dark cherry red' climbing by 235%.

2. Surreal Soirees

Surreal Soirees For your New Year's Eve hosting, expect a shift towards surrealism in tablescapes. Think curvy candlesticks and gravity-defying centerpieces. Searches for the Salvador Dali aesthetic and modern surrealism are on the rise.

3. Castlecore

Castlecore Inspired by the grandeur of medieval castles, the castlecore aesthetic combines dramatic finishes and historical references to create regal interiors. With searches for 'medievalcore' up 110%, this trend is gaining momentum.

4. Primary Play

Primary Play 2025 will embrace a playful spirit in home design, encouraging fun touches and DIY projects. Expect to see more hand-painted decor and vibrant contrasts in trims.

5. Mix and Maximalist

Mix and Maximalist This trend champions an eclectic mix of colors, patterns, and styles, focusing on curated chaos. With searches for 'eclectic maximalism' up 215%, this approach emphasizes layering unexpected elements harmoniously.
